Features
|
Cordless system with digital answering machine includes 3 handsets, 1 base, and 2 chargers Uses 1.9 GHz frequency band for less interference Digital answering machine with 16 minutes recording time Up to 17 hours talk time 3-way conference calling capability

Customer Rating:      Summary: Great phone with no interference... Comment: This phone works great - no interference even in a heavily populated apartment building with lots of wireless networking around. All three handsets work great - plus, I can customize the phonebook on each one so I don't have to go through long lists of numbers to get to the one I want (e.g. in my office I only store the numbers I use for work, the one in the living room has friends and family on it, etc).
Battery life appears to be excellent so far - I do a lot of teleconferencing that can last for 2-3 hours and have yet to have a battery run low during that time. I also like the voicemail notification (I don't use the answer machine) since it gives a notice on the display and flashes the light on top - I can quickly see if I have any messages waiting instead of having to actually pickup the phone.
The only reason I didn't give it 5 stars is because of the volume when using a headset. There are volume controls for all three ways to use this phone - standard, speakerphone, and headset. The standard and speakerphone volumes are excellent, but the headset volume is a little too low even when set to maximum. Fortunately, my Plantronics headset has a bit of volume boost, so I can get it to a level that works well.
Other than that one tiny issue, I have been very happy with this phone!

Customer Rating:      Summary: Phone system works fine for us Comment: We bought this to replace an AT&T digital answering system that stopped taking messages. The Panasonic phones are easy to use. Setup was very simple as the instructions are will written and easy to follow.
We have used the phone outside over 100 feet from a base and it works fine with no signal drop. The intercom feature is very helpful from upstairs to downstairs. No more yelling across our home. The ability to pick up messages from any phone is great as our answering machine base is in an upstairs office.
